
We are delighted to hear that the all-new Toyota Aygo X Hybrid won the WhatCar? Small Car of the Year award.
Launched in December 2025, this model is recognised as a practical compact car with class-leading features and low operating costs. As the first small city car in the A-segment to adopt a full hybrid system, the Toyota Aygo X Hybrid will make it easier for drivers who prefer smaller vehicles to transition to electric vehicle driving.

Thanks to its advanced hybrid powertrain and Continuously Variable Transmission (CVT), the new Aygo X Hybrid provides a smooth and comfortable ride, delivering a combined power of 116hp and accelerating from 0 to 62 mph in just 9.2 seconds.
The Aygo X features a wide stance while maintaining a compact feel inside to provide comfort and cosiness. The seats are made from SakuraTouch fabrics, a blend of plant-derived PVC, waste cork, and recycled PET. This not only offers a soft and pleasant feel but also reduces CO2 emissions during material production by 95%. Additionally, the Aygo X has a practical 231-litre boot capacity, making it perfect for big shopping trips or holidays.
